The GACP Constitution allows for others who wish to run for 4th VP the liberty of announcing their candidacy up to the close of the business meeting at the Winter Training Conference. Once that meeting closes, no other candidates can run.
Voting members are considered Active members in good standing, as well as Life members. However, only one Active member may vote per agency. Good standing generally means that your dues must be paid. Payment of dues often are done when registering for the Winter Training Conference. If you are not attending the Winter conference, please make sure your dues are paid ASAP or at least before the STC or you will not be permitted to vote. Also, as per the GACP Constitution, if your
$100 dues are not received before January 31st, a late fee of $25.00 will be levied. Life Membership is granted by the GACP Executive Board to thank you for your many years of service as a GACP dues paying head of a law enforcement agency.
